#347d2a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#347d2a is composed of 20.4% red, 49% green and 16.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 58.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 66.4% yellow and 51% black. It has a hue angle of 112.8 degrees, a saturation of 49.7% and a lightness of 32.7%. #347d2a color hex could be obtained by blending #68fa54 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336633.

Shades and Tints of #347d2a

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030803 is the darkest color, while #f8fdf8 is the lightest one.

Tones of #347d2a

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#515651 is the less saturated color, while #17a403 is the most saturated one.
